Standards for a Good Reflective Essay W.9-10.5 Develop and strengthen writing as needed by planning, revising, editing, rewriting, or trying a new approach, focusing on addressing what is most significant for a specific purpose and audience. (Grade-specific expectations for writing types are defined in W.9-10.1-3.) W.9-10.4 Produce clear and coherent writing in which the development, organization, and style are appropriate to task, purpose, and audience. W.9-10.3 Write narratives to develop real or imagined experiences or events using effective technique, well-chosen details, and well-structured event sequences. Write informative/explanatory texts to examine and convey complex ideas, concepts, and information clearly and accurately through the effective selection, organization, and analysis of content. Write arguments to support claims in an analysis of substantive topics or texts, using valid reasoning and relevant and sufficient evidence.Ĭommon Core Writing Standard 2. It must make the significance of the event clear.Ĭonclusion: The conclusion should reflect on the outcome of the incident and present the writer’s feelings. It recreates the incident with specific details. A reflective essay should introduce the incident about which you are writing, including principal characters and setting.īody: The body is the actual narrative part of the reflective essay. Introduction: A narrative essay doesn’t necessarily have the same type of introduction as an expository or persuasive essay.
